Boiling Fish is Delicious, But the Smoked Delicacies Steamed Rice is Even Better! 🍚 🌟 Just a one-minute walk from Main St. subway station, on the second floor of the adjacent mall. The ambiance is particularly elegant, and for a moment, it feels like dining in a mall back home. 🥬 Pre-Dinner Snack: The crispy and salty Sichuan-style Chinese cabbage is a hit with my Northeastern friends. For those who prefer lighter flavors, it’s best enjoyed with rice. Haha. 🐟 Boiling Fish The perch served sizzles delightfully. The fish is tender, and the generous portions of mung bean sprouts and cucumber strips add a refreshing touch. The unique flavor of Sichuan peppercorns enhances the aroma of the fish! 🌶️ Despite its bright red appearance, it’s not spicy at all. The texture is smooth and rich, making it palatable even for those from Guangdong. 🦆 Smoked Aromatic Duck with Sichuan Peppercorns This cold dish comes in a substantial portion. The duck is infused with a rich, smoky flavor and the aroma of Sichuan peppercorns, making it a great accompaniment to rice. 🥘 Mother’s Pig’s Feet Soup The pig’s feet are cooked to a tender yet fibrous texture, with the added bonus of soft and chewy tendons. The kidney beans are soft and starchy. The soup is rich and flavorful, even more so with a drizzle of chili oil. 🌟 It’s satisfying on its own, but the thick, aromatic broth is perfect for warming the stomach and nourishing the body.
